Background
Pest control is to reduce or prevent pathogenic microorganisms and pests from harming crops, and some measures are taken artificially, and generally divided into chemical control by using chemical substances such as pesticides and physical control by using physical energy such as light or rays or building barriers.
At present, the most common method for preventing and treating plant diseases and insect pests in the agricultural field is solved by spraying pesticides, but the pesticides can only be sprayed on the tops of crops regardless of manual pesticide spraying or machine pesticide spraying, the pests at the lower parts of the crops cannot be killed, and the disease and insect pest prevention and treatment effect is limited.

The working principle is as follows: the utility model discloses, the staff only need open case lid 4 earlier when using, then the inside of water tank 3 is poured into to the liquid medicine of allotment again, then open transfer pump 6 through the controller, transfer pump 6 can be with the inside liquid medicine suction of water tank 3 to the inside of pipe 12 this moment, and then input to inside shower 14, then the staff only needs both hands to hold handrail 2, place the gyro wheel 9 of both sides respectively in the escape canal in the field, the equipment can cover three ridges crops simultaneously this moment, and crops all lie in between two shower 14, then the staff only needs to promote the handle in the field and can promote the equipment whole to move forward, and the equipment is when moving forward, the through-hole 21 of shower 14 both sides also can spray the department pesticide, and then spray the pesticide on the crops of both sides; when the device is used, a worker can insert an inner hexagonal wrench into the inner six holes 27 and then rotate the inner six holes 27, the worm 25 is driven to rotate, the worm wheel 24 is driven to rotate, the threaded rod 8 drives the cross rod to ascend and descend at the moment due to the fact that the worm wheel 24 and the threaded rod 8 are meshed with each other, the height of the device can be adjusted according to the height of crops, when the height of the device is adjusted to be proper, the worker only needs to screw the threaded connector 23 on the spray pipe 14 into the threaded groove 22 at the moment, the number of the spray pipes 14 can be determined according to the height of the crops, the more spray pipes 14 are connected, the higher the height of the crops is, the smaller the spray pipes 14 are connected, the lower the height of the crops is, and after the spray pipes 14 are connected, the worker only needs to open the second valve 19 on the connecting pipe 18 and the first valve 15 on the spray pipes 14, the device can be suitable for crops with different heights, and in use, the first valve 15 on the last spray pipe 14 needs to be closed.
